Job description

Structural engineering for critical, complex projects

We’re looking for a Structural Engineer to join our growing team and help deliver innovative, high‑impact projects across multiple sectors. You will play a key role in power and energy schemes, from substations and grid infrastructure to renewable energy facilities, while also contributing to projects in industrial, defence and transportation environments.

This is an opportunity to work on infrastructure that matters.

What you’ll be doing
  • Designing and specifying structural elements across complex, multidisciplinary projects, with a strong focus on power and energy infrastructure
  • Producing high‑quality drawings, specifications and technical reports in line with industry standards
  • Collaborating with engineers across disciplines to deliver safe, efficient and sustainable solutions
  • Reviewing calculations, drawings and supplier submissions to ensure technical excellence and compliance
  • Supporting and mentoring early‑career engineers while contributing to continuous technical improvement
What we’re looking for
  • A degree in Civil or Structural Engineering, or equivalent
  • Proven structural design experience in at least one sector BakerHicks operates in, with power sector experience highly desirable
  • Working towards Chartered or Incorporated status with ICE or IStructE
  • Experience using structural analysis software such as MasterSeries, STAAD or Tedds
  • Strong working knowledge of Eurocodes, British Standards and CDM regulations
  • A collaborative communicator who thrives in multidisciplinary environments
  • Eligibility for security clearance, essential for certain projects
  • UK project experience gained through employment, internships or graduate placements
